How-to Guide
1. Insert WPS Art
Entry: Insert tab → WPS Art
- Open the presentation you want to edit.
- Click the Insert tab at the top of the window.
- Find and click WPS Art.
- Wait for the WPS Art panel to open.
Success Criteria
- Interface result: The WPS Art selection panel appears.
- Next action available: You can continue browsing and selecting a layout.
Tips While Using
- Common mistake: If you are not in the presentation editing view, you may not see the entry.
- Environment note: The presentation file should open normally in WPS Presentation.
2. Choose a Suitable Layout
Entry: WPS Art panel
- Browse the available layouts in the WPS Art panel.
- Select the WPS Art type that matches your content structure.
- Click OK to insert the graphic.
Success Criteria
- Interface result: The selected WPS Art graphic is inserted into the current slide.
- Next action available: You can type text into the graphic.
Tips While Using
- Common mistake: If the layout does not match the content structure, later editing may take longer.
- Suggestion: For users searching how to insert SmartArt in presentation-style workflows, list, process, and cycle layouts are usually the most direct starting points.
3. Enter and Adjust Content
Entry: The inserted WPS Art graphic
- Click a text box inside the graphic.
- Enter the text you want to display.
- If you need to adjust the layout, switch to the Design tab.
- Change the layout as needed, or press Ctrl+Z to undo and choose again.
Success Criteria
- Interface result: Your text appears in the graphic, and layout changes are visible.
- Next action available: You can continue formatting, arranging, or saving the presentation.
Tips While Using
- Common mistake: Entering too much text before confirming the layout can create extra rework later.
- Suggestion: Confirm the structure first, then fill in the content.
